How they compare
Viet Nam currently reports 1,916 kt against 1,120 kt in Venezuela (Bolivarian Republic of), a difference of 796 kt.
That makes Viet Nam's figure about 1.7 times Venezuela (Bolivarian Republic of)'s.
Across all 34 years both countries report, Viet Nam has been ahead every year.
Venezuela (Bolivarian Republic of) ranks 6th and Viet Nam ranks 4th of 22 countries.
Viet Nam has averaged higher in every one of the 4 decades both report.
Head to head by decade
| Decade | Venezuela (Bolivarian Republic of) | Viet Nam |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 920.58 kt | 1,664 kt | 743.13 kt | Viet Nam |
| 2000s | 1,072 kt | 1,927 kt | 855.15 kt | Viet Nam |
| 2010s | 1,071 kt | 1,992 kt | 921.43 kt | Viet Nam |
| 2020s | 1,111 kt | 1,916 kt | 804.43 kt | Viet Nam |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
